Principal Consultant - Utility Cost of Service & Regulatory Finance Expert

Concentric Energy Advisors, Inc. ( ) (“Concentric”) is a leading management consulting and financial advisory firm focused on the North American energy industries. Concentric specializes in financial advisory assignments; market assessment and strategy development; ratemaking and utility regulation; litigation support; and management and operations consulting. Concentric was founded in 2002 as Concentric Energy Advisors and is headquartered in Marlborough, MA, with additional offices in Washington, DC and Calgary, Alberta, Canada.

Job Description:

We are seeking a highly experienced Principal Consultant - Utility Cost of Service & Regulatory Finance Expert to join our team working remotely and provide our utility clients with expert level knowledge in cost of service and regulatory finance. This role is ideal for senior utility/energy executives and consulting professionals with at least 15 years of experience in utility regulatory work who are ready to take the next step in their consulting career. This individual will serve as a subject matter expert and expert witness in allocated cost of service studies, lead-lag analyses, cash working capital, and affiliate transaction rules. The ideal candidate will have a strong track record of regulatory testimony and deep expertise in utility finance and ratemaking principles.

At Raytheon, the foundation of everything we do is rooted in our values and a higher calling – to help our nation and allies defend freedoms and deter aggression. We bring the strength of more than 100 years of experience and renowned engineering expertise to meet the needs of today's mission and stay ahead of tomorrow's threat. Our team solves tough, meaningful problems that create a safer, more secure world.

Raytheon Mechanical Engineering (ME) is the premier organization for mechanical hardware design, development, production, and research. ME strives to minimize total systems cost, while maximizing production. This is achieved through commitment, training and continuous improvement using common tools and processes. The capabilities encompass a broad range of technical disciplines which include engineering, operations, technical services, materials and processes, analysis and test and documentation.

The Mechanical Engineering Department is seeking an Senior Engineer to provide Site Development and Integration expertise. The Site Development & Integration section performs large scale, complex site development and onsite support. Engineers will perform research, design, support construction and development of military and commercial facilities.

RTX Corporation is an Aerospace and Defense company that provides advanced systems and services for commercial, military and government customers worldwide. It comprises three industry-leading businesses – Collins Aerospace Systems, Pratt & Whitney, and Raytheon. Its 185,000 employees enable the company to operate at the edge of known science as they imagine and deliver solutions that push the boundaries in quantum physics, electric propulsion, directed energy, hypersonics, avionics and cybersecurity. The company, formed in 2020 through the combination of Raytheon Company and the United Technologies Corporation aerospace businesses, is headquartered in Arlington, VA.
